Kurvex wayfinding offers visability legibility, comprehensibility and credibility

Can you read it?

Visibility. Can the sign be seen?
Legibility. Is the sign legible from a distance?
Comprehensibility. Does it give clear instruction?
Credibility. Can it be trusted?

Visibility, make sure it’s seen first, the Kurvex Wayfinding System is designed to stand out from the background, thats why the symbols and typography in the system have a strong family resemblance. If the pedestrian is in unfamiliar territory the Kurvex Wayfinding System will quickly become the recognisable point of information and a source of direction.

Our system offers optimum visibility for the pedestrian in an unfamiliar environment, the the typeface used has been specifically designed for signage and the team of designers at Kurvex have taken in to account factors such as reading angles, colour and layout because these elements affect legibility.

DDA - The Disability Discrimination Act

At Kurvex we are fully aware of The DDA requirements relating to signage. However, we believe there is more to meeting the needs of disabled users than simply installing tactile signs. We do not believe signage for the disabled should be considered simply out of political correctness in order to meet the requirements of legislation, but must be part of a complete solution to aid all user groups alike.
